Senior Lead Software Engineer- IOS & Android Native at JPMorgan Chase within Consumer & Community Banking, based in Columbus, OH. You will lead an agile team, drive technical direction across iOS and Android mobile apps, develop secure production code, review others' work, and influence product design and technical operations. You will collaborate with UX designers to prototype features, optimize performance, and support modern practices including CI/CD and Site Reliability Engineering (SRE).

Location: Columbus, OH, United States

Be an integral part of an agile team that's constantly pushing the envelope to enhance, build, and deliver top-notch technology products.

As a Senior Lead Software Engineer at JPMorgan Chase within Consumer & Community Banking, you will be a vital member of an agile team dedicated to enhancing, building, and delivering trusted, market-leading technology products in a secure, stable, and scalable manner. You will drive significant business impact through your expertise and contributions, applying deep technical knowledge and advanced problem-solving skills to address a wide range of challenges across multiple technologies and applications.

Job Responsibilities

  • Provide technical guidance and support to business teams, contractors, and vendors.
  • Develop secure, high-quality production code; review and debug code written by others.
  • Make decisions that impact product design, application functionality, and technical operations.
  • Advise peers and project stakeholders on the adoption of new technologies.
  • Develop mobile applications for iOS using Swift, SwiftUI, and Objective-C.
  • Develop mobile applications for Android using Java and Kotlin.
  • Optimize applications for various mobile devices, including iPhone, iPad, Apple Watch, and Android devices.
  • Work on large-scale mobile apps, implementing complex front-end solutions and automated testing.
  • Collaborate with UX designers to prototype and implement new features for improved user experiences.
  • Optimize mobile applications for speed, reliability, and scalability; follow Agile practices such as Scrum and Continuous Delivery.
  • Support Site Reliability Engineering (SRE) practices to ensure excellent user experience and system performance.

Required qualifications, capabilities, and skills

  • Formal training or certification in software engineering and 5+ years of applied experience.
  • Experience in system design, application development, testing, and maintaining operational stability.
  • Proficiency in at least one programming language relevant to mobile development.
  • Strong knowledge of mobile development frameworks, including iOS (Swift, Objective-C, UIKit, Cocoa) and Android (Java, Kotlin).
  • Familiarity with iOS design patterns (MVVM, MVC, MVP, VIPER, etc.).
  • Experience integrating native features such as Camera, Push Notifications, GPS, CoreML, and VisionKit.
  • Understanding of mobile application security, including device registration, biometrics, encryption, and data protection.
  • Experience with API integration and use of development tools like Xcode.
  • Knowledge of OAuth, SSO, and NFC technologies.
  • Experience building and releasing apps to the App Store or enterprise stores using CI/CD pipelines.
  • Proficiency with Git, source code management, and Agile software development methodologies.

Preferred qualifications, capabilities, and skills

  • Experience with Agile/Scrum and Waterfall development methodologies.
  • Experience testing mobile applications on devices and simulators for both iOS and Android.
  • Familiarity with build automation tools and frameworks for static and dynamic analysis.
  • Ability to assess technology risks, perform threat modeling, and communicate risk to stakeholders.
  • Experience building relationships with cross-functional teams, including technology, business, audit, and risk partners.
